Job Description
- Application Deadline: Thu, 31 Jul 2025 00:00:00 GMT
- Position: Information Communication Technology Officer
- Job Type Full Time
- Qualification BA/BSc/HND
- Experience 3 years
- Location Abuja
- Job Field ICT / Computer 
Job Description
- Maintains computer systems and software to ensure they are running smoothly.
- Troubleshoots and resolves technical issues that arise with computers or software.
- Implements security measures to protect computer systems from viruses and unauthorised access.
- Manages the organization’s database and ensures data backups are made regularly.
- Helps users with computer-related problems and offers advice on how to use software or hardware appropriately.
- Tests and evaluates new hardware and software to determine if they are suitable for the organisation.
- Provides training to employees on how to use computer systems and software effectively.
- Keeps up to date with advancements in computing technology and recommends upgrades or changes as necessary.
- Conduct regular system audits to identify vulnerabilities, replace damaged components, and arrange for necessary repairs.
- Collaborate with vendors and service providers for the procurement of ICT equipment and services, ensuring cost-effective solutions.
- Prepare reports and documentation on the status of ICT operations and project progress.
- Any other assignments that might be given to you by your supervisor
Web Development
- Designing, building, or maintaining websites and software applications.
- Coding and scripting using various languages and tools.
- Testing and optimising website elements for functionality and performance.
- Maintain communication with team members and supervisors concerning the direction of the website.
- Perform routine site audits, as well as ongoing maintenance, on an as-needed basis.
Experience and Education Requirements
- Bachelor’s degree in computer science or a related field
- Minimum of 3 years working in IT
- Experience in project management, security systems, or database design can also be an added advantage.
- Prolific experience working with HTML, CSS, SQL
- An experienced fullstack developer with experience in PHP
- Demonstrable experience in the Web Development process with the ability to interpret ideas into graphical prototypes
- Experience using Content Management Systems like WordPress to create a unique website.
- Good experience designing UI/UX
- Proficient with Figma for designing User Interface.
- Good communication skills to explain complex ideas to non-technical people.
Key Performance Indicators (KPIs):
- System uptime and reliability.
- Resolution time for technical support requests.
- Successful implementation of technology upgrades or projects.
- User satisfaction with ICT services.
- Microsoft SharePoint 2010
- Data Protection, FOI
- Investigative
- LAN and WAN
- Negotiation
- Relationship Management
- Microsoft Active Directory,
- Microsoft and Linux server technologies,
- Microsoft Office 365 and Exchange,
- cloud-based storage systems,
- Windows OS, MS Office Suites, Citrix and PowerShell